Easy Ways To Take Care Of Your Fibreglass Pools

Fibreglass inground pools are made in one piece and are ready to install, making them easier to clean and maintain. When compared to other pool types, the non-porous gel-coat surface of fibreglass pools necessitates less frequent cleaning. Cleaning and appropriate maintenance of water chemistry, surfaces, and water levels are the foundations of basic fibreglass pool maintenance. Because of the inert surface of fibreglass pools, fewer water chemistry adjustments are required. The most important aspect of fibreglass pool maintenance, however, is testing and maintaining your water. Maintain proper water chemistry to ensure bather safety and equipment longevity by using the best kit that will keep your swimming pool sanitised and maintain the pH level of the water, checking the hardness, cyanuric ...
... acid in a regular manner and so on.



Bring a water sample to a professional pool dealer when you open your pool, once a month during the swimming season, and before you close your pool for complete water analysis. Aside from routine testing, bring in a sample whenever you have a water problem that you can't solve on your own.



The best way to clean a fibreglass pool is the same way you would clean any other inground swimming pool: regular skimming, brushing and vacuuming. The smooth, gel-coat surface, on the other hand, necessitates less brushing and overall cleaning, which must be done with a much gentler touch.



When it comes to cleaning the fibreglass swimming pool in Toowoomba, be sure to use a nylon-bristled brush that won’t make any scratch on the surface of the pool. If you want to remove the heavier deposits from the inner part then you can also use a vacuum cleaner. This will make your task easier as well as simpler. For cleaning the pool, never ever use any harsh cleaning agent that will damage the gel-coating of your swimming pool.
